Fix totalPoints not showing in infraction embed
This commit is contained in:
parent
9e5508781a
commit
0dc63e1d97
@ -163,14 +163,16 @@ class ModerationManager {
|
|||||||
|
|
||||||
responses.push(await escalation.execute());
|
responses.push(await escalation.execute());
|
||||||
continue;
|
continue;
|
||||||
} else {
|
|
||||||
infraction.totalPoints = await userTarget.totalPoints(message.guild, { points, expiration, timestamp: infraction.timestamp });
|
|
||||||
}
|
}
|
||||||
|
|
||||||
}
|
}
|
||||||
|
|
||||||
|
infraction.totalPoints = await userTarget.totalPoints(message.guild, { points, expiration, timestamp: infraction.timestamp });
|
||||||
|
|
||||||
}
|
}
|
||||||
|
|
||||||
responses.push(await infraction.execute());
|
responses.push(await infraction.execute());
|
||||||
|
|
||||||
}
|
}
|
||||||
|
|
||||||
const success = Boolean(responses.some((r) => !r.error));
|
const success = Boolean(responses.some((r) => !r.error));
|
||||||
|
@ -37,7 +37,6 @@ class SlowmodeInfraction extends Infraction {
|
|||||||
rateLimitPerUser: this.data.seconds
|
rateLimitPerUser: this.data.seconds
|
||||||
}, this._reason);
|
}, this._reason);
|
||||||
} catch(e) {
|
} catch(e) {
|
||||||
console.error(e);
|
|
||||||
return this._fail('INFRACTION_ERROR');
|
return this._fail('INFRACTION_ERROR');
|
||||||
}
|
}
|
||||||
|
|
||||||
|
@ -156,7 +156,7 @@ class Infraction {
|
|||||||
}
|
}
|
||||||
|
|
||||||
if(this.points && this.points > 0) { //TODO: Add expiration to INFRACTION_DESCRIPTIONPOINTS
|
if(this.points && this.points > 0) { //TODO: Add expiration to INFRACTION_DESCRIPTIONPOINTS
|
||||||
description += `\n${this.guild.format('INFRACTION_DESCRIPTIONPOINTS', { points: this.points, total: this.pointsTotal, expires: Util.duration(this.pointsExpiration) })}`;
|
description += `\n${this.guild.format('INFRACTION_DESCRIPTIONPOINTS', { points: this.points, total: this.totalPoints, expires: Util.duration(this.pointsExpiration) })}`;
|
||||||
}
|
}
|
||||||
|
|
||||||
if(this.description && this.description instanceof Function) {
|
if(this.description && this.description instanceof Function) {
|
||||||
@ -206,6 +206,8 @@ class Infraction {
|
|||||||
reason: this.reason,
|
reason: this.reason,
|
||||||
data: this.data,
|
data: this.data,
|
||||||
flags: this.flags,
|
flags: this.flags,
|
||||||
|
points: this.points,
|
||||||
|
expiration: this.expiration,
|
||||||
modLogMessage: this.modlogMessageId,
|
modLogMessage: this.modlogMessageId,
|
||||||
dmLogMessage: this.dmlogMessageId,
|
dmLogMessage: this.dmlogMessageId,
|
||||||
modLogChannel: this.modlogId,
|
modLogChannel: this.modlogId,
|
||||||
|
Loading…
Reference in New Issue
Block a user